Tiffany Lopinsky: Co-Founder and COO of ShopMy

Tiffany Lopinsky is the co-founder and chief operating officer of ShopMy, the groundbreaking tech company that is the preeminent platform used by content creators to share and monetize their product recommendations. Lopinsky studied government at Harvard, where she launched Boston Foodies, an Instagram account showcasing the city's best restaurants. The account grew to over 150,000 followers, giving her firsthand insight into the world of content creation. After graduation, she worked in business strategy and analytics at Arnold Worldwide, a global ad agency, and Popcart, a small start-up. At Popcart, she met her future co-founder, Harry Rein, who was working on a little side project—an online storefront where you can share products you like—and sought her advice. Eventually, they teamed up with another co-founder, Chris Tinsley, to create ShopMy. The platform launched in 2020 and quickly became invaluable to both creators and brands through its sophisticated affiliate network. Lopinsky and her co-founders have continued to refine and expand the platform, creating new programs that allow creators to have a steady income from brands and helping brands connect with creators who genuinely care about their products. Last month, they announced a $77.5 million Series B funding round, allowing them to expand into new markets and categories.

Candace Nelson: Sprinkles Cupcakes Founder

Few people can be credited with starting a national food craze like Candace Nelson did. The pastry chef and entrepreneur sparked America's cupcake obsession when she opened Sprinkles Cupcakes in 2005, the first of its kind in the world. In the third episode of our podcast, Second Life, Nelson explains why she pivoted from a banker to baker and how she harnessed the power of saying “no."

Jenna Bans: Hollywood Showrunner and Creator of NBC's Good Girls

Jenna Bans's résumé is scarily similar to the list of TV shows we love to binge. As a producer and writer on Grey's Anatomy, co–executive producer on Scandal, and creator of NBC's new crime drama, Good Girls, she's the creative force behind some of the most popular shows of this generation. In episode two of Second Life, Bans opens up about ditching law school to pursue screenwriting, working with Shonda Rhimes, and learning to lead fearlessly.

Jen Atkin: "The World's Most Influential Hair Stylist"

In our very first episode, host Hillary Kerr sits down with the one and only Jen Atkin, celebrity stylist and founder of cult haircare line Ouai. Dubbed the "most influential hairstylist in the world" by The New York Times, Atkin counts Bella Hadid, Chrissy Teigen, and Kendall Jenner as clients. Here, she gets candid about the power of social media, reflects on her journey from salon apprentice to CEO of a thriving business, and explains why mental toughness is the most underrated quality.
